Commanders CB Marshon Lattimore Arrested: What It Means for His Career and Washington’s Defense
SHARE

Washington Commanders cornerback Marshon Lattimore was arrested on weapons charges in Ohio, marking his second such incident in five years. This latest legal trouble adds to his recent struggles on the field, raising serious questions about his future with the team and his NFL career.

The Arrest: What Happened

Marshon Lattimore, the Washington Commanders’ cornerback, was arrested Wednesday evening in Lakewood, Ohio, a suburb west of Cleveland, on charges of carrying concealed weapons and improperly handling firearms in a motor vehicle. According to police reports, the arrest occurred around 6:15 p.m. after a traffic stop for expired license plates and other violations. During the stop, Lattimore allegedly failed to disclose the presence of a firearm in the vehicle, leading to his arrest. He was briefly booked into jail before being released without bond.

A Troubling Pattern

This isn’t the first time Lattimore has faced legal trouble involving firearms. In 2021, while playing for the New Orleans Saints, he was arrested in Cleveland under similar circumstances—possessing a loaded handgun that had been reported stolen. He later pleaded guilty to a misdemeanor charge of carrying a concealed weapon, receiving a suspended sentence and a year of probation. The recurrence of such incidents raises concerns about a pattern of behavior that could have serious implications for his career.

Impact on the Commanders

Lattimore’s arrest comes at a critical time for the Commanders, who acquired him in a November 2024 trade with the Saints. The move was initially praised as a strategic pickup, given Lattimore’s reputation as a four-time Pro Bowl cornerback. However, his tenure in Washington has been marred by injuries and inconsistent performance. Last season, he appeared in only two regular-season games due to health issues. This season, his play was shaky before he was placed on injured reserve in November with a torn ACL, ending his season prematurely.

Lattimore’s Career Trajectory

Lattimore’s career has been a mix of highs and lows. A standout at Cleveland’s Glenville High School, he went on to become a first-team All-Big Ten cornerback at Ohio State. His NFL career began with promise, earning Pro Bowl honors four times during his tenure with the Saints. However, his recent struggles—both on and off the field—have cast a shadow over his once-stellar reputation.

What’s Next?

The Commanders have acknowledged the arrest and are gathering more information, stating they have informed the NFL League Office. As the legal process unfolds, the team will need to weigh the risks and rewards of keeping Lattimore on the roster.
